For optimal results with these best dermatologist-recommended vitamin C serums for glowing skin, apply in the morning after cleansing, followed by moisturizer and SPF. Patch test new products, store in cool dark places to maintain potency, and consult a dermatologist for personalized advice. Consistent use unlocks smoother, brighter skin that turns heads.
